Overview

UIC Sand & Gravel seeks a Heavy Equipment Operator who is responsible for operating a variety of heavy construction equipment, including excavators, shovels, tractors, scrapers, and motor graders, to excavate, move, and grade earth and materials. The role requires skilled manipulation of controls such as joysticks, pedals, and hand-wheels to operate attachments like blades, buckets, and booms. This position also involves supervising other operators and laborers, and coordinating work activities with other trades and subcontractors to ensure safe and efficient project execution.

Responsibilities

Essential functions to include:

  • Excavate to specified grades using appropriate heavy equipment.

  • Supervise material delivery and export by coordinating with trucking operators and suppliers.

  • Coordinate and schedule earthmoving operations with the Project Superintendent to support progress of other trades.

  • Complete work within established timeframes and budget constraints.

  • Tend pumps, compressors, or generators to power tools, machinery, or equipment, or to heat/move materials.

  • Perform additional duties as assigned by the Project Superintendent.

Knowledge and Critical Skills/Expertise:

  • Ability to read and interpret construction plans and specifications.
  • Skilled in setting up and assembling rigging and hoisting equipment.
  • Proficient in operating motor graders, front-end loaders, backhoes, and excavators.
  • Skilled in using basic construction equipment, including forklifts and skid steers.
  • Performs all duties and operates tools in strict compliance with OSHA safety standards.
